Understanding Sub-Second Instabilities in a Global Cyber-Physical System

pdf

Abstract: Future CPS will include large, decentralized systems of semi-autonomous sensor and actuator components, and will need to operate safely beyond human response times. One current data-rich example is the U.S. network of electronic exchange networks which is the largest and fastest network CPS in existence, but is already known to produce a wide variety of sub-second instabilities that are little understood and which impact safety, efficiency and accuracy.
